Visa Free
No visa is required to enter this country
As the name elaborates, you don't need any visa to enter this country.
The purpose of the whole concept is to enable an individual to enter a particular country without obtaining any visa in advance or at arrival.
Nonetheless, this doesn't apply to every country. Instead, your country has to sign an agreement with any other country to allow you and all other citizens to travel without any visa. For instance, you are a resident of one particular country named X, and your government has signed an agreement with another country: Y. So, now you can travel to this country with a free visa. You just would need a valid passport & your bags.
Nonetheless, note that you can’t stay in a Visa-free country for an unlimited period. Instead, the total duration for an individual to stay in a visa-free country varies.
So, Please check with the embassy of the country before you travel.
